首页 > 在线学习

jtag引脚定义 ttl(JTAG引脚定义 TTL:为你详细解读)

什么是JTAG?

JTAG全称为Joint Test Action Group,是一种用于芯片测试与编程的标准化接口。它可以提供一个单一的、简单的、标准的测试方法,适用于开发硬件和嵌入式软件。JTAG接口不仅可以用于板级测试和故障排除,还可以用于更新或烧录嵌入式设备上的程序。

JTAG引脚定义

JTAG接口定义了一组用于和JTAG设备交互的信号线。其中包括4条固定线TCK、TMS、TDI、TDO和一些电源与地线。TCK (Test Clock) 是测试时钟,TMS (Test Mode Select) 是测试模式控制线,TDI (Test Data In) 是测试数据输入线,TDO (Test Data Out) 是测试数据输出线。TCK引脚是一个时钟异步信号,由调试器产生。TMS引脚是一个同步信号,用于指示状态机状态的改变。TDI引脚用于在测试模式下输入数据。TDO引脚用于从测试模式中读取数据。这四个信号线与所有JTAG设备兼容,构成了JTAG协议的核心。

JTAG和TTL的关系

TTL是一种数字电平接口标准,可用于通过数字电平直接传输串行数据。TTL信号是一种较为通用的串行通信解决方案。通常,TTL芯片的引脚是设置为输入或输出。因此,在使用TTL接口时,需要定义数据信号的引脚,以确定数据输入和输出的状态。JTAG可以使用TTL等各种数字电平方式,因为TTL的引脚定义方式可以匹配JTAG的引脚配置。但JTAG引脚定义与TTL的不同之处在于,JTAG定义了一套复杂的状态机,用于控制设备的测试和调试*作,而TTL则没有这样的机制。因此,JTAG需要更多的引脚来支持完整的状态机。

JTAG引脚定义TTL优势

JTAG引脚定义TTL具有很多优势。首先,它可以为设计师提供一种标准化的测试和编程接口。其次,JTAG接口可以访问芯片内部的寄存器和其他内部资源,可以方便地读取和修改芯片状态和寄存器。JTAG也可以简化电路板测试和故障排除的过程,减少硬件设计周期、提高硬件测试效率。除此之外,JTAG对于嵌入式系统来说是一个非常重要的调试接口,通过这个接口可以在不影响系统正常运行的情况下对系统进行调试。相比传统的方式,JTAG引脚定义TTL可以更加灵活地运用,也可以大大简化调试过程,提高调试效率。

如何使用JTAG引脚定义TTL

使用JTAG引脚定义TTL一般需要进行以下步骤。首先,需要通过JTAG工具验证芯片的JTAG连接状态,然后确认芯片的JTAG IDCode。接下来,需要检查Flash编程器和板连接状态,进行连接后,可以选择读取、写入、擦除Flash等*作。在使用JTAG引脚定义TTL时,也需要注意电压和电平的匹配问题。因为JTAG接口支持多个电压级别,在使用时应该选择合适的电压。同时,由于JTAG需要高速通信,线路绕线过程中引脚长度、电极容量、单元负载及信号损失等问题必须注意。

总结

JTAG引脚定义TTL是一种非常方便的数字电平接口标准,它可以为设计师提供一种标准的测试和编程接口方案,实现简单、安全、高效的测试和编程。同时,JTAG也可以作为嵌入式系统调试的重要接口,帮助开发者更好地进行故障排除和调试工作。因此,JTAG引脚定义TTL应该得到更广泛的应用和推广。

本文链接:http://xindalouti.com/a/33105794.html

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件举报,一经查实,本站将立刻删除。